Dev suggestion - active attack power display
LouCypher
Posts: 111
Hey devs, it would be nice to have a readout in the buff icon area that shows the current attack power bonus (passive, masteries, synergies, and buffs totalled up). Could also do for armor I suppose... these ideally would be toggled on/off in the game settings.

When I’ve got synergies, combat buffs proccing, and star seeker going I want to know at any time what my attack bonus is.
There are 'hidden' abilities and features (exact armour ratings, attack buff percentages, etc) that even experienced players cannot know these stats for sure. Sure you have a feel for it, but there is no certainty. Some transparency could make the fights more fun and give players more information to make choices about which attacks to use when and which bots to invest in in the long run.
